Unable to Buy QuickBooks Desktop Premier

Unable to Buy QuickBooks Desktop Premier can be confusing for users who are looking for a new version of the traditional QuickBooks Desktop Premier accounting software, especially when older websites, advertisements, or software listings still appear to offer Premier for purchase. For customers in the United States, Intuit stopped selling new QuickBooks Desktop Premier Plus subscriptions after September 30, 2024, which means a new customer generally cannot purchase a new Premier Plus subscription through the normal QuickBooks purchasing process. This change applies to new subscriptions and is different from completely discontinuing the product for every existing customer. Existing eligible QuickBooks Desktop Premier Plus subscribers can continue to use and renew their subscriptions according to the applicable terms, while customers who did not previously have an eligible subscription may need to consider another QuickBooks product. Intuit has identified QuickBooks Desktop Enterprise as its desktop accounting solution for customers who need to purchase a new desktop product, while QuickBooks Online is another option for businesses that are comfortable moving their accounting to a cloud-based platform. Because of this change, someone searching for QuickBooks Desktop Premier 2024, Premier 2025, Premier 2026, or a new lifetime Premier license may find conflicting information online, so it is important to distinguish legitimate product availability from third-party listings. Websites claiming to sell new perpetual or lifetime copies of Premier should be approached carefully, particularly when the price is unusually low or the seller is not an authorized source. Purchasing an unsupported or unauthorized copy can create problems with installation, activation, updates, connected services, security, and technical assistance. Existing Premier users should first determine their current product version and subscription status before assuming they need to purchase a new license. A customer who already has an eligible Premier Plus subscription may have renewal options even though a new customer cannot start a Premier Plus subscription. This distinction is important because the end of new sales does not necessarily mean that every existing Premier installation stops working immediately. However, older desktop versions can eventually reach their service-discontinuation dates, and discontinued versions may lose access to services such as payroll, online banking, payments, technical support, and security updates. For example, Intuit’s current service-discontinuation information states that QuickBooks Desktop 2023 products, including Premier Plus 2023, were discontinued after May 31, 2026. This means users who are still relying on an affected older version should evaluate their options rather than waiting until an essential connected service stops working. If you currently use Premier and want to continue with a desktop accounting environment, QuickBooks Desktop Enterprise may be worth evaluating because it remains available for new desktop customers, although Enterprise is not simply a renamed version of Premier and has different features, capabilities, pricing, and licensing. Businesses should compare the number of users they need, inventory requirements, reporting needs, industry-specific functionality, payroll requirements, integrations, and overall accounting workflow before deciding whether Enterprise is appropriate. QuickBooks Online may be more suitable for users who prefer browser-based accounting, remote access, automatic updates, and cloud collaboration. Before switching from Premier to another product, create a reliable backup of the existing company file and preserve important historical reports so that the original accounting records remain available for reference. This is especially important when the company file contains years of transactions, customized invoices, memorized reports, payroll history, inventory information, customer balances, vendor records, or specialized accounting configurations. If the goal is to continue working with existing data, investigate migration options before creating a completely new accounting company because manually rebuilding years of accounting history can be time-consuming and can introduce additional errors. Users should also review whether all Premier features they currently depend on are available in the replacement product. A business using advanced inventory or industry-specific features may have different requirements from a business that primarily creates invoices, tracks expenses, reconciles bank accounts, and generates financial reports. Making a feature checklist before changing products can help prevent unexpected limitations after the transition. When moving from Premier, users should also review how their existing data will map into the replacement product because some features and settings may not transfer in exactly the same format. After migration, compare important financial reports with the original Premier records, including the Balance Sheet, Profit and Loss, customer balances, vendor balances, bank balances, and other reports relevant to the business. Investigate differences before treating the new system as the final source of accounting records. Avoid making unsupported adjustments simply to force the new balances to match the old system because differences may result from data mapping, conversion limitations, account classifications, or missing historical information. A careful review of the original and converted records can help identify the actual reason for any discrepancy.
